Transaction 2c93fa676694a26b75cb2314a158aaf965233a2923fffac9028f3b9993b6825c

2 Input
2 Outputs
  • 2c93fa676694a26b75cb2314a158aaf965233a2923fffac9028f3b9993b6825c:0
  • value  1000000
    address  msvfeDuwDuUusNBPqk7tvnFXvMPm2MRuq3
  • 2c93fa676694a26b75cb2314a158aaf965233a2923fffac9028f3b9993b6825c:1
  • value  1397280
    address  2MzWphQPCxawxuijUsiZk5Mh52Za1qtaLbr